the question is:

-3x-2z-7
if x=3 and z= -1

i did the the question and got the answer - 14 ....but the answer key that i got say -20....can anyone help me... with this plz....

4 answers

What I would do is replace the variables with the numbers and set it up like this:

(-3 x 3) + (-2 x -1) -7.

What's strange is that I got -14, too. The key could be incorrect, I have had mistakes in my math book before. If this homework isn't being graded, don't stress out about it, I'm sure your teacher will understand if it's not right. Good luck!
-3(3)-2(-1)-7
-9+2-7= -14
